For a parallel beam of monochromatic light of wavelength λ diffraction is produced by a single slit whose width a is of the order of the wavelength of the light. If D is the distance of the screen from the slit, the width of the central maxima will be
Options
(a) 2Dλ/a
(b) Dλ/a
(c) Da/λ
(d) 2Da/λ
Correct Answer:
2Dλ/a
